>Description:
The following two (very small) kernel patches add support for the Epson Perfection 1650 USB scanner.
>How-To-Repeat:
>Fix:
The patches should be applied in /usr/src/sys/dev/usb. They are located at:
<http://ironorchid.com/jjinux/patches/scanner.diff>
It is important to remember to run "make -f Makefile.usbdevs" after applying the patches. Albeit small, this is my first kernel patch! :)
